The people who are paid to use it as part of their jobs are researchers and scientists. rDNA technology is a major arm of genetic engineering which has been applied to the manufacturing of pharmaceuticals, particularly therapeutic proteins such as insulin [21,56], human serum albumin, human papillomavirus vaccine, and hepatitis B vaccine [37,60]. Learn about the history, techniques, and applications of genetic engineering. Paul Berg made the first recombinant DNA molecule in 1972 by combining a lambda virus with the monkey virus SV40. Genetic engineers alter, splice, eliminate, and rearrange genes in order to modify an organism or groups of organisms. Where and how they work depends on the project. New DNA may be inserted in the host genome by first isolating and copying the genetic material of interest using molecular cloning methods to generate a DNA sequence, or by synthesizing the DNA, and then inserting this construct into the host organism.
